The Federal Reserve’s FedNow is a service that allows banks and credit unions to transfer funds more quickly. It’s not a form of currency, nor is it a move towards eliminating cash, the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System stated. WebContrary to most federal employees initial thoughts, finding your correct amount of creditable service is often the most time consuming of all three. The complexity stems from the fact that OPM calculates your creditable service from your standard form 50’s (SF 50’s). An employee separates from federal service An employee who transfers to ... netgear a7000 slow speedhttp://retirement.federaltimes.com/2024/02/27/reserves-service-credit/ it was about 600 years agoWebShould you leave federal service prior to 3 years, you forfeit this 1%. This automatic agency 1% is the only agency contribution that requires a 3 year vesting period. Every other agency contribution (i.e. the match) is vested immediately. Once you reach 3 years of Federal Service you are 100% vested in the agency automatic 1%. netgear a7000 wifi usb3.0 adapter update
